Dickeya dianthicola (Samson) causing blackleg and soft rot was first detected in potatoes grown in Maine in 2014. Previous work has suggested that insects, particularly aphids, may be able to vector bacteria in this genus between plants, but no conclusive work has been done to confirm this theory. In order to determine whether insect-mediated transmission is likely to occur in potato fields, two model potato pests common in Maine were used: the Colorado potato beetle (Leptinotarsa decimlineata Say) and the green peach aphids (Myzus persicae Sulzer). Adipose tissue can be characterized as either being a white (energy storing) depot or a brown (energy expending) depot and both have been found to contain dense networks of neural innervation. This adipose nerve supply regulates numerous metabolic functions and likely plays an important role in the function of adipose blood vessels.
